Daily Parking Charges Across West Northamptonshire
In West Northamptonshire, parking costs vary significantly depending on location and time of day. At Abington Place, weekday charges range from £0.50 for 30 minutes to £6.60 for all-day parking. Albion Place offers longer stays at £8.80 daily. Both locations provide free parking for two hours on weekends, making them attractive for residents and visitors. Blue Badge holders enjoy free parking at these council car parks, supporting accessibility across the region.
Campbell Square follows similar pricing with £1.10 for the first hour, escalating to £5.50 for five hours. Evening rates are a flat £2.20, allowing parking until 10 am the next day. Many council car parks throughout Northampton Town accept both cash and contactless card payments, streamlining the parking experience. Frequently Asked Questions
What are the hourly parking rates in West Northamptonshire?
In West Northamptonshire, specifically in Northampton Town, hourly parking rates vary by duration. For instance, the first hour costs £1.10, while parking up to three hours will set you back £3.30. Rates increase incrementally, with a maximum charge of £6.60 for all-day parking.
What is the daily maximum parking rate in West Northamptonshire?
The daily maximum parking rate in West Northamptonshire's Northampton Town is £6.60. This allows you to park your vehicle all day, making it a convenient option for those visiting local attractions or businesses.
Where can I find the cheapest parking options in West Northamptonshire?
The cheapest parking option in West Northamptonshire is available at Abington Place, where you can park for free for the first two hours on Saturdays and Sundays. After that, the fee is just £2.20 for the evening, making it an economical choice for evening outings.
What payment methods are accepted for parking in West Northamptonshire?
In West Northamptonshire, car parks like Abington Place accept both cash and card payments. Whether you prefer using coins or a card, you can easily pay for your parking without hassle, ensuring a smooth experience.
Are there different parking charges on weekends in West Northamptonshire?
Yes, parking charges in West Northamptonshire are notably different on weekends. In Northampton Town, you can park for free for the first two hours on Saturdays and Sundays, after which a fee of £2.20 applies for evening parking. This makes weekend visits more affordable.
